Camp-In Party 10yr

We just had a Camp-In" sleepover birthday party that my son said was "the best party EVER". Guests arrived and were greeted with "Welcome to Camp Yadthrib!"  (Birthday spelled backwards and were given a bandana (which they wore on their heads).  Guests were told on the invitations to bring PJs sleeping bags & pillows flashlight boots toothbrush & toothpaste.  We gave each parent a pre-made slip of paper with our home phone and cell phones and we had a pre-printed list of the kids' & parents' names and home numbers onto which they added their cell numbers. The boys put their things into the tent which was set up in our great room then were invited to the kitchen to make their own trail mix. They wrote their names onto a brown lunch bag selected their ingredients then shook to mix. Ingredients were Chex cereal granola raisins dry roasted peanuts mixed nuts roasted sunflower seeds and m&ms. Shortly after all arrived it was time for camp grub.  They roasted hot dogs in the family room fireplace side dishes were cowboy beans and cheesy potatoes drinks were root beer lemonade and bottled water.  A cooler with bottled water was always available in the kitchen & the cooler doubled as an extra seat at the table. The boys decided to go outside & play and luckily we had lots of snow they played in the snow fort and had snowball fights.  When they came in they had cocoa to warm up (with extra marshmallows on the side).  Next it was game time.  They played "Worst Case Scenario Survival card game with a modified format. Each player got 3 pieces of paper and wrote an A on one and a B and a C. The party boy's older sister (and self-appointed "camp counselor") read questions out loud and the A B C answers. Each player then held up their answer card.  We kept a tally of the correct answers. Great game and lots of really good discussion about why each answer was the best option so this was fun AND educational - always a plus! Next birthday apple pie ice cream gifts. The plates & napkins were all camouflage colors.  Also used plastic camo cups so that they could re-use and take home. Treat bags had candy camo- note pad bungee pop granola bar and a VERY cool key chain with a REAL bug in acrylic. The rest of the evening included movies board games card games and using their flashlights to make shadow puppets using a book from the library. Decorations were minimal - just balloons - the tent was really all that was needed. (Should have done a sign but we came up with camp name a little too late.) Unfortunately there were no brave souls to lead the group in campfire songs! We decided to send home S'mores "kits" rather than add to their sugar buzz. Downloaded a recipe from the Hersheys website for Indoor S'mores using the microwave. In the morning the boys had cocoa while I had my coffee - much needed of course not much sleeping as expected. I got lucky for breakfast since I live near a VFW and today was the monthly "Farmer's Breakfast".  Served all of us for only $30 and they have THE BEST pancakes anywhere! I asked my son to rate the party on a scale of 1 to 10 he gave it "Four billion and three".  Other ideas that we had but did not do:  go on a nature walk identify animal tracks using a book from the libray.  Make a pendant and put an amimal track or leaf print tie to a leather cord.  Campfire songs. Flashlight tag.  Put up a Christmas tree next to the tent. Play nature sounds in the background.  Great party everyone had a blast. If you're brave enough to try a sleep-over with boys then this is definitely the theme to use! :)"
